intermixture
简明释义
英[ˌɪntəˈmɪkstʃə]美[ˌɪntərˈmɪkstʃər]
n. 混合;混合物
英英释义
The act or process of mixing two or more substances together. | 将两种或多种物质混合在一起的行为或过程。 |
不同元素或成分的组合或混合。 |
